As far as I know, the publisher database (as per SQL) is the only database
we can make changes to and hence if the publisher is down, no changes can be
done.
probably you are sonfused because you can add phones on subscriber as well
but in fact when you are adding the phones on the subscriber, you are
actually making changes to the publisher database which is then repluicated
between to the subscribers....
